Functional Layout
- Reception & Waiting Area: A spacious, well-lit zone with ergonomic seating, digital check-in kiosks, and calming color tones to reduce anxiety.
- Consultation Rooms: Soundproofed and equipped with modern furnishings for privacy and comfort.
- Lab & Imaging Zones: Designed with hygiene and efficiency in mind—featuring anti-bacterial surfaces, optimized lighting, and clear zoning for different tests (e.g., X-ray, ultrasound, blood work).
- Staff Lounge & Admin Zone: Separate from patient areas to ensure focus and relaxation for medical personnel.
Materials & Mood
We used medical-grade vinyl flooring, antimicrobial wall panels, and soft LED lighting. The color palette includes whites, soft blues, and greens—chosen for their calming psychological effects.
Design Challenges
- Space Optimization: We had to accommodate multiple diagnostic functions within a limited footprint. Modular furniture and vertical storage helped maximize usability.
- Patient Comfort: Acoustic insulation and natural light were key to reducing stress and improving the overall experience.
